In the rapidly evolving landscape of cannabis concentrates, the Maybanger strain has emerged as a standout hybrid, capturing the attention of both seasoned connoisseurs and curious newcomers. While its precise genetic lineage remains a topic of discussion among cultivators, Maybanger is celebrated for its unique "badder" consistency—a whipped, cake-batter-like texture that sets it apart in a competitive extract market. This comprehensive guide delves into every aspect of the Maybanger strain, from its origins and chemical profile to its distinctive effects and optimal consumption methods. As cannabis culture continues to innovate with new extraction techniques and product formulations, understanding what makes Maybanger special provides valuable insight into the future of potent, flavorful concentrates.

The Maybanger strain, when cultivated for its flower, typically produces dense, resin-coated buds that shimmer with a frosty layer of trichomes. The nugs often exhibit deep green hues intertwined with vibrant orange pistils, creating a visually striking appearance. As a hybrid, Maybanger plants tend to display robust growth characteristics, making them suitable for various cultivation environments. They generally have a moderate flowering time and can offer respectable yields to patient growers who maintain optimal humidity and nutrient levels. The plant's structure is often bushy, benefiting from strategic pruning to ensure adequate light penetration and air circulation throughout the canopy.

The aromatic profile of the Maybanger strain is a complex and inviting symphony that immediately engages the senses. Upon first encounter, a profound earthy foundation greets you, reminiscent of fresh soil after a rainstorm. This is swiftly complemented by bright, zesty citrus notes—think ripe lemons and oranges—that cut through the earthiness with a refreshing sharpness. As the aroma develops, distinct pine undertones emerge, evoking a walk through a coniferous forest. The final layer reveals a subtle spiciness, akin to black pepper or cloves, adding warmth and depth to the overall bouquet. This intricate blend makes the Maybanger strain a memorable olfactory experience before consumption even begins.

When experienced, the effects of the Maybanger strain unfold in a harmonious cascade that beautifully balances cerebral stimulation with physical ease. Users typically report an initial wave of euphoria that lifts the mood and sparks a sense of joyful well-being. This mental uplift is closely followed by a surge of creativity, making the Maybanger strain an excellent companion for artistic endeavors, brainstorming sessions, or engaging conversations. The hybrid nature ensures this cognitive stimulation doesn't lead to anxiety; instead, a gentle physical relaxation sets in, melting away tension without causing sedation. The overall experience is one of focused calm and inspired thought, allowing users to remain productive and socially engaged while enjoying a profound sense of contentment. This makes the Maybanger strain versatile for both recreational enjoyment and therapeutic application.

To fully appreciate the Maybanger strain, consider these consumption guidelines. For those using the concentrate (badder), low-temperature dabbing is highly recommended to preserve the delicate terpene profile and ensure a smooth, flavorful hit. This method allows users to experience the full spectrum of Maybanger's complex flavors. If consuming the flower, a clean glass piece or dry herb vaporizer will provide the purest taste. Given its balanced hybrid effects, the Maybanger strain is exceptionally versatile regarding timing. Many find it perfect for afternoon or early evening use, when its creative and euphoric effects can enhance activities without interfering with sleep. Start with a small amount to gauge individual tolerance, as its potency can be significant.

Growing Information

Moderate difficulty. Flowering time of approximately 8-9 weeks. Can produce medium to high yields with proper care in controlled environments.
